The reality is that the strongest predictor of payout is the name of the author. There are very many bots operating on this platform, and the most common of these either vote for pre-defined author lists or are dumb vote-followers and vote for posts once they see that some other account has voted for them.

I've created a more advanced bot that is neither of these. My bot learns what kinds of posts make big rewards, and then votes for them - and the biggest thing it's learned so far is that the easiest way to predict a post's payout is to look at the author. It's not a very good system yet, but that's the state of things.
